Taw qhia rau lub voj voog ntawm tes
Lub voj voog ntawm tes yog tus txheej txheem uas ib lub cell faib thiab tsim ob lub hlwb zoo tib yam. Nws yog ib qho kev tshwm sim tseem ceeb hauv kev loj hlob thiab kev loj hlob ntawm ntau cov kab mob, nrog rau kev hloov cov hlwb puas lossis tuag. Cov txheej txheem no tau ua nyob rau hauv ntau theem tseem ceeb uas ua kom muaj qhov tseeb duplication thiab cais cov khoom siv caj ces.
El lub voj voog ntawm tes Nws muaj peb theem tseem ceeb: interface, mitosis y citocinesis. Thaum lub sij hawm interphase, lub cell ua feem ntau ntawm nws cov haujlwm thiab npaj rau kev faib. Nws tau faib ua peb theem: theem G1, theem S thiab theem G2. Thaum lub sij hawm G1, lub cell loj hlob thiab ua haujlwm metabolic li qub. Hauv theem S, DNA duplication tshwm sim, thaum nyob rau hauv G2 theem, lub cell npaj rau qhov kawg faib.
Mitosis yog ib theem tseem ceeb ntawm lub voj voog ntawm tes uas cov khoom siv caj ces muab faib thiab faib sib npaug ntawm cov menyuam ntxhais. Nws tau muab faib ua ob peb theem: prophase, prometaphase, metaphase, anafase thiab telophase. Thaum lub sij hawm prophase, chromosomes condense thiab cov microtubules ntawm mitotic spindle yog tsim. Hauv prometaphase, microtubules txuas mus rau chromosomes thiab rub lawv mus rau hauv kev sib dhos ntawm cov phaj equatorial thaum lub sijhawm metaphase. Tom qab ntawd cov chromosomes sib cais thiab txav mus rau cov ncej ntawm lub cell thaum lub sij hawm anaphase. Thaum kawg, hauv telophase, ob tug ntxhais nuclei raug tsim thiab cov chromosomes decondense.

Cov noob tseem ceeb koom nrog hauv kev tswj hwm lub voj voog ntawm tes
Lawv yog cov tseem ceeb los lav qhov kev loj hlob thiab kev loj hlob ntawm cov kab mob no tswj cov txheej txheem sib txawv uas tshwm sim thaum lub sij hawm ntawm lub voj voog ntawm tes, ua kom lawv cov kab ke raug thiab tiv thaiv kev loj hlob ntawm cov hlwb txawv txav. Hauv qab no yog qee cov noob tseem ceeb tshaj plaws koom nrog hauv txoj cai no:
p 53 ygo:. Cov noob no ua lub luag haujlwm tseem ceeb hauv kev tiv thaiv qog nqaij hlav thiab tiv thaiv qog noj ntshav. Nws ua raws li cov qog suppressor, txwv tsis pub kev loj hlob ntawm cov hlwb puas lossis hloov pauv. Thaum kuaj pom DNA puas lawm, p53 noob induces kho lossis programmed cell tuag, tiv thaiv kev sib kis ntawm cov hlwb txawv txav.
CDK (Cyclin-dependent kinase) noob: Cov noob no encode protein enzymes uas tswj cov kev loj hlob ntawm lub voj voog ntawm tes CDKs ua los ntawm kev khi rau cov cyclins tshwj xeeb hauv ntau theem ntawm lub voj voog, yog li ua rau lawv tus kheej ua haujlwm thiab tso cai rau kev hloov mus rau theem tom ntej. Cov kev cai meej ntawm cov enzymes no yog qhov tseem ceeb los tiv thaiv cell proliferation.
Rb tsev neeg genes: Lub Rb (Retinoblastoma) tsev neeg cov noob ua lub luag haujlwm tseem ceeb hauv kev tswj tsis zoo ntawm kev faib tawm ntawm tes Cov noob no encode cov proteins uas ua raws li cov qog nqaij hlav, tiv thaiv lub voj voog ntawm tes kom txog thaum cov xwm txheej tsim nyog rau kev faib tawm. Rb proteins khi rau cov kev hloov pauv, yog li tswj kev qhia ntawm cov noob lub luag haujlwm rau kev nkag mus rau theem S thiab G2.

DNA microarray tsom xam:
DNA microarray tsom xam yog cov txheej txheem uas tso cai rau ntsuas qhov qhia txog ntau txhiab tus noob tib lub sijhawm. Nws muaj cov hybridization ntawm cDNA sau nrog cov kev sojntsuam tshwj xeeb ntawm DNA array ntawm microchip. Qhov kev siv ntawm lub teeb liab tawm yog cuam tshuam nrog tus neeg xa xov RNA (mRNA) tam sim no hauv cov qauv. Nyob rau hauv txoj kev no, nws muaj peev xwm txheeb xyuas cov noob uas nws cov lus qhia txawv nyob rau hauv ntau theem ntawm lub voj voog ntawm tes.
Real-time polymerase chain reaction (real-time PCR):
Real-time PCR yog cov txheej txheem uas tso cai rau kom muaj nuj nqis ntawm mRNA tam sim no hauv cov qauv dhau sijhawm. Siv cov fluorescent probes uas khi rau PCR cov khoom, tus nqi ntawm mRNA generated nyob rau hauv txhua amplification voj voog yuav txiav txim. Cov txheej txheem no tshwj xeeb tshaj yog muaj txiaj ntsig zoo rau kev txheeb xyuas cov noob qhia hauv lub sijhawm tiag tiag, txij li thaum nws tso cai rau kuaj pom sai thiab meej cov kev hloov pauv hauv gene qhia.
RNA sequencing (RNA-seq) tsom xam:
RNA sequencing tsom xam yog cov txheej txheem tiam tom ntej uas tso cai rau kom tau txais cov ncauj lus kom ntxaws txog cov noob qhia ntawm qib sib lawv liag. Yog li, nws muaj peev xwm txheeb xyuas thiab ntsuas qhov sib txawv ntawm cov ntawv sau tseg uas tau tsim thaum lub voj voog ntawm tes. Cov thev naus laus zis no muab kev pom tag nrho ntawm cov noob qhia thiab tso cai rau kev tshawb pom ntawm cov ntawv teev lus tshiab thiab isoforms.
